Description

Botanical Interests' Spring Melody Blend Poppy Seeds (Eschscholzia californica) deliver a brilliant mix of pink, rose, red, orange, white, and yellow blooms in single, double, and semi-double forms. These stunning flowers thrive in full sun, adding vibrant color to gardens and landscapes. With its heat- and drought-tolerant nature, this California poppy blend requires minimal care while providing essential food for pollinators. Blooming from spring to frost, it often self-sows, ensuring a recurring display of beauty for years to come. Perfect for mass plantings, this low-maintenance flower is ideal for pollinator-friendly, water-wise gardens.

Botanical Name: Eschscholzia californica
Family: Papaveraceae
Native: North America
Hardiness: Perennial in USDA zones 8–10; usually grown as an annual.
Plant Dimensions: 6″–12″ tall and wide
Variety Information: 2″–3″ pink, rose, red, orange, white and yellow single, double and semi-double flowers.
Type: California
Exposure: Full sun
Bloom Period: Spring to frost
Attributes: Attracts Pollinators, Deer Resistant, Drought Tolerant, Heat Tolerant

When to Sow Outside: RECOMMENDED. 4 to 6 weeks beforeyour average last frost date, when soil temperature is 50°–60°F, or early to mid-fall for bloom the following spring. Mild Climates: Late summer to early fall for winter and spring bloom.
When to Start Inside: Not recommended; roots sentitive to disturbance.
Days to Emerge: 7–14 days
Seed Depth: Scatter and rake in lightly
Thinning: When 1″ tall, thin to 1 every 4″–6″
